I observed this with fuzzy match handling, not sure whether this is an issue for other records.
The original records:
com,twitter)/i/videos/tweet/731859894710718465?conviva_environment=test&embed_source=clientlib&player_id=1&rpc_init=1 20160805135628 https://twitter.com/i/videos/tweet/731859894710718465?embed_source=clientlib&player_id=1&rpc_init=1&conviva_environment=test text/html 200 OQCJZ7JKWZI37BWVSOJMM7MYHARP5XK4 - - 3163 294009561 ...
com,twitter)/i/videos/tweet/731859894710718465?conviva_environment=test&embed_source=clientlib&player_id=2&rpc_init=1 20160805135628 https://twitter.com/i/videos/tweet/731859894710718465?embed_source=clientlib&player_id=2&rpc_init=1&conviva_environment=test warc/revisit 0 OQCJZ7JKWZI37BWVSOJMM7MYHARP5XK4 - - 1068 294017704 ...
Only one record returned from outbackcdx after ingest:
fuzzy:com,twitter)/i/videos/tweet/731859894710718465? 20160805135628 https://twitter.com/i/videos/tweet/731859894710718465?embed_source=clientlib&player_id=2&rpc_init=1&conviva_environment=test warc/revisit 0 OQCJZ7JKWZI37BWVSOJMM7MYHARP5XK4 - - 1068 294017704 ...
Note that I was able to update this record properly by re-posting only the status 200 record.
